Visualizing data in a way that people can understand is very important in the age of data-driven decision-making. Charts and graphs help us understand complex data, trends, and patterns easily.
Let’s explore how to create a simple chart using Chart.js, a popular JavaScript library for data visualization.

What Is Chart.js?
Chart.jsis a free tool that helps developers make interactive charts for web apps. The HTML5 canvas element renders the charts, allowing them to work on modern browsers.
Features of Chart.js
The features include:
Setting Up the Environment
you may set up the library in one of two ways:
Basic HTML Structure
To embed a chart, you’ll need a canvas element in your HTML. Here’s a basic structure:
To style the page, create a file,style.css, and add the following CSS to it:

Crafting Your First Chart: A Bar Chart Example
For this example, we’ll use a bar chart, ideal for comparing individual data points by category.
At the moment, your chart looks like this:
Styling and Customizing the Chart
Chart.js offers a multitude of options to customize charts such as:
As a simple example, you can set some basic styles for your dataset by changing the options object as follows:
Your chart should now look like this:
Best Practices and Performance Tips
To ensure optimal performance when rendering charts:
Tips to Avoid Common Pitfalls
Here are some pitfalls to avoid:
Chart.js: Empowering Web Data Visualization
Chart.js is a useful tool when you want to display interactive data in an attractive way. You can easily create beautiful data visualizations that provide insights and inform decisions.
Chart.js provides a strong solution for visualizing data, whether you’re experienced or new to development.